Introducing WAL Failover
With CockroachDB release 24.3 we are introducing write-ahead log (WAL) failover, a solution for transient disk stalls commonly seen in cloud storage. During a disk stall, the underlying storage is not available, adding application latency. While we can’t prevent disk stalls, WAL failover helps minimize their impact on CockroachDB instances.
